Baseball Goes 1-1 In Doubleheader Against SBU

BOLIVAR, Mo. - Truman State baseball split Saturday's doubleheader with SBU, winning the first game 6-3 and were defeated 9-8 in the second.

Game One:

Holden Missey had another good game on the mound and at the plate in game one, throwing five innings with six strikeouts and two earned runs. He went 1-4 batting as well.

SBU scored the first run of the game in the fourth inning on a fielding error by Truman. The Bulldogs struck back in the fifth, taking a 2-1 lead when Luke Turner hit a two-RBI double. Southwest Baptist retook the lead in the bottom of that inning with an RBI triple and a sacrifice fly. Truman scored three runs in the sixth to take a 6-3 lead. Dylan Thompson hit an RBI double, Simon Murray hit an RBI single, and Tal Dean reached on a fielding error that scored Grant Beck and Murray.

Tal Dean went 1-4 with two RBIs.

Luke Turner went 1-4 with two RBIs.

Game Two: 

There was plenty of offense in game two, with each team having two players with multiple hits.

Truman scored two in the first when Luke Roussel walked with the bases loaded, and Will Fromm hit a two-RBI single.

SBU scored six unanswered in the second and fourth, and the Bulldogs were able to tie the game at six in the fifth. Tal Dean hit an RBI triple, Luke Turner drove Dean in on a groundout, and Holden Missey hit a homer to left.

SBU's Smock hit a three-run home run in the fifth, making it a 9-6 Bearcats lead.

The Bulldogs tried to rally in the sixth, with Tal Dean scoring Grant Beck on a groundout and Luke Turner bringing Murray in with a sacrifice fly.

Tal Dean added another two hits, going 2-4 with two RBIs and two runs.

Simon Murray went 2-4 with two runs.

Holden Missey went 1-3 with a home run.

Will Fromm got a hit in four tries, driving in two.

Luke Turner had two RBIs in the game.

Truman plays the final game of the series tomorrow at noon.
